IMPORTANT!
•You can adjust the volume level of movie audio during movie playback only.
Editing a Movie
Use the procedure in this section to edit and delete movies. Editing operations let you cut everything before or after a specific frame, or to cut everything between two frames.
IMPORTANT!
•Cut operations cannot be undone. Make sure you really want to cut the part of the movie you are specifying before executing the cut operation.
•A movie that is shorter than five seconds cannot be edited.
•The cut operation can take considerable time. This is normal and does not indicate malfunction.
•You will not be able to perform the cut operation if the amount of memory available is less than the size of the movie file you are cutting. If this happens, delete any files you no longer need to free up more memory.
•Splicing of two different movies into a single movie or cutting one movie into multiple parts are not supported by camera operations. However, you can splice movies and cut movies into multiple parts on your computer using the bundled Ulead Movie Wizard SE VCD application.
